The Role:
We are seeking a highly skilled Project Site Engineer to drive engineering excellence on-site and in the yard. You will coordinate complex operations, manage critical project documentation, and work closely with clients, operational teams, and our home office engineering department. This role operates on a FIFO (Perth) 2 weeks on and 1 week roster, offering focused periods on-site balanced with extended time at home.
What You will Do:
* Update, review, and manage project documentation, drawings, procedures, and deliverables registers.
* Maintain documentation status, including management of change and latest approved procedures.
* Directly communicate with client representatives on engineering and operational matters.
* Prepare project schedules and detailed operation timelines in collaboration with Project Site Manager, Operations Manager, and Yard Manager.
* Conduct route surveys for Self-Propelled Modular Transporters (SPMTs) and identify preconditions for safe project execution.
* Coordinate engineering activities on-site and in the yard, maintaining clear communication with the home office and client engineering teams.
* Support site supervision of lifting, transport, and load-out activities.
* Ensure technical information is exchanged accurately, documentation is up-to-date, and deliverables are communicated to all relevant parties.
* Facilitate proper coordination between engineering, operational teams, subcontractors, and third parties during project execution.
* Manage engineering change processes in collaboration with on-site teams and the home office.
* Assist operational teams during route surveys and prepare reports for clients or civil authorities to enable project progress.
